      Pioneer recollections of the 30's and 40's in Sandusky ....
      COMMEMORATIVE BIOGRAPHICAL RECORD of the Counties of
      SANDUSKY AND OTTAWA, OHIO, biographical sketches of prominent and
      representative citizens, and of many of the early settled families.
      James Mitchell Bowland
      page 421
      Adam Brunthaver, Patriach of the Brunthavers of Green Creek,
      and Ballville townships, Sandusky Co., Ohio, was born near
      Greensburg, Westmoreland Co., Penn. His father was a native of Alsage,
      France, who served as a soldier in the capacity of teamster, under
      the First Napoleon, and subsequently emigrated to America, where he
      was employed by the United States Government to drive cattle through
      the wilderness, from Pennsylvania to the military post at Detroit,
      Mich. He was always on friendly terms with the Indians, learned to
      converse with them, and served with his party as interpreter. . . .
      . . . He was married, in Pennsylvania to Miss Mary Ridenhour, and
      first settled in Fairfield county, Ohio. . . . Mrs. Mary Brunthaver
      died in the fall of 1835. Of their children: Sally, wife of John
      Purdy, of Ballville township; Esther, wife of Mr. Bowman, of Fulton
      county, Ohio; Henry, who married Miss Emma Cook, now residing at
      Clyde, Ohio; Christena, wife of Luther Van Horn, of Portland, Mich.;
      John who married Miss Matilda Scouten, and settled in Green Creek
      township; and Leah, wife of Enos Osborn, of Ballville township.
      In 1839 Adam Brunthaver married Mary Smith, daughter of Adam
      Smith, who had settled in Green Creek township, in 1824. The children
      by this marriage were:
      Louis, who married Miss Loraine Folgeron; wife of Bert Rathbone;
      Lucinda, wife of John Duesler; Minerva, who died single;
      Adam, who married Miss Olive Potter;
      Delila, wife of Norton Young;
      William, who married Miss Ann Smith; and
      Martha, wife of Owen Maurer.
      These families reside in Green Creek and Ballville townships.
      The death of Adam Brunthaver, Sen., occurred April 28, 1860, at
      the age of seventy-five years. He was buried in Long's graveyard, now
      known as Mount Lebanon U. B. Cemetery, in Ballville township. To this
      place the remains of his first wife were removed from the pioneer
      Kernahan burial place. Mr. Brunthaver's widow married, in 1861, Rev.
      Israel Smith, of Fremont. . . . Mr. Smith died in 1885, and his widow
      has since that time occupied the Smith homestead, . . .
